I applied online. The process took 8 weeks. I interviewed at eBay (San Jose, CA) in Aug 2020
Interview
Everything was over zoom
- Recruiter interview
- Two screening (people management, architecture)
- Virtual onsite ( 6 interviews focused on people, project, system design, resume based project deep dive, biggest mistake, challenging project, managing under performer)
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
- People Management: Growth plans, recruiting
- Project management: failures, process
- Resume based project deep dive

I applied online. The process took 1+ week. I interviewed at eBay (Portland, OR) in Nov 2022
Interview
Recruiter reached out to me 2 days after sending my application. Was asked to provide pre-screen details (i.e why eBay, why this role, salary expectations, etc.) Was scheduled to zoom meet with a member (Engr Mgr) from the team. Was given feedback the same day after the screen. The team picked another candidate. It was a positive experience. Recruiting/coordination was quick and stream-lined. I received several reminders of my upcoming interview day.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Q: What opportunities are you looking for? Q: How would your members describe you? Q: How do you manage low performers Q: Should business logic be at the client side? Q: What skills (i.e hard, soft) you can use more of? Q: Describe Microservice
